Driver rolls furniture truck near Tarras

A Christchurch truck driver escaped unscathed from a crash early yesterday when the furniture truck she was driving rolled off State Highway 8 and slid on its side down a small river bank near Tarras.

The incident occurred about 8.30am on Cluden Hill, 10km north of Tarras, as the driver navigated the heavy truck around a bend.

The woman, who asked not to be named, was taking furniture from Christchurch to Cromwell and was the sole occupant of the vehicle.

She was not injured in the crash, which left the front of the truck and a road sign damaged.

Constable Doug Winter, of Cromwell, said police would continue their investigation once the truck had been taken to Cromwell.

A crane from Cromwell lifted the truck on to its wheels yesterday afternoon, and another furniture truck arrived at the scene to transport the cargo.

It is not yet known whether speed was a factor in the crash, or if charges will be laid in relation to the incident.
